Transaction fb84d8f57b151072e63a3b7f265234b02c71e0b05ae5e99b0c9cc5b563b0367e
1 Input
1 Output
-
fb84d8f57b151072e63a3b7f265234b02c71e0b05ae5e99b0c9cc5b563b0367e:0
- value
- 28314
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2e04435d29bc8897094b8acfd5bbf28342157d92 OP_EQUAL
- address
- 35tL7aNNPafBnA8d8bePw2ozPhCTpTTrHf